The Brother Ephrem O’Bryan, OSB, Endowed Chair for Excellence in Teaching was awarded to Jeff Ingle at Subiaco Academy Feb. 16. Headmaster Mike Berry said, “Each year Subiaco Academy names a member of the faculty as an Endowed Chair recipient. The purpose of the Endowed Chair Program is to ensure and maintain high educational standards by rewarding outstanding faculty in specific disciplines and providing facilities that will enrich the life of the Academy today and for generations to come.”
Ingle, who obtained a bachelor’s degree in fisheries and wildlife biology, received his non-traditional licensure and began teaching at Paris Middle School. In 2014 he joined Subiaco Academy as a math teacher and academic guidance counselor. He and his wife have two sons who attend Subiaco Academy.
